Transaction c725878915e71cf0611cae83f135bd87c442049cd089c51a0d0c06bdcc513620

1 Input
2 Outputs
  • c725878915e71cf0611cae83f135bd87c442049cd089c51a0d0c06bdcc513620:0
  • value  726142539
    address  14XC3xeTpr6ELP4bCcRWsKupCo2WnZc1wd
  • c725878915e71cf0611cae83f135bd87c442049cd089c51a0d0c06bdcc513620:1
  • value  1964190
    address  3KYbn6PBYfzXiCdrk8nVs8KtMvri6pPWi8